Output 2efe88b540061a75f9b7350d1c08f809d9e7b878d14ff9b8eb083caaee0368f8:11

value
10538944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a202634aaa5a7f6ad26c6664b5a1206f1fe7bde5 OP_EQUAL
address
3GTeFXnSxTx7XVPNGPc5Q9dcsJfCuuvKiK
transaction
2efe88b540061a75f9b7350d1c08f809d9e7b878d14ff9b8eb083caaee0368f8
confirmations
507987
spent
true